Abstract
An imaging system includes: an optical system configured to form a subject image; a driver configured to drive the optical system; an imaging element configured to capture the subject image and generate image data; and a processor configured to control the imaging element and the driver. The imaging element includes: a first imaging portion configured to capture an image of a first light beam that travels through a first optical path in the optical system; a second imaging portion configured to capture an image of a second light beam that travels through a second optical path shorter than the first optical path; and plural phase difference pixels for phase difference autofocus, the plural phase difference pixels being arranged in at least one of the first imaging portion and the second imaging portion, the plural phase difference pixels being configured to output phase difference signals.
